A divorced man from Malaysia recently made headlines after making a heartbreaking decision — sending his three young children to an orphanage because he could no longer afford to care for them. His tearful goodbye captured the raw pain of a father who loved his children deeply but was defeated by life’s relentless hardships.
Once a hardworking man with dreams of giving his family a better future, everything changed after his marriage ended. Left to raise his children alone, he struggled to keep food on the table and a roof over their heads. Despite working long hours and taking on small jobs, the rising cost of living pushed him to the edge. Eventually, he realized that love alone wasn’t enough to provide his children with what they needed — safety, education, and daily meals.
The moment he arrived at the orphanage, his heart shattered. Holding back tears, he explained that he wasn’t abandoning them, but trying to give them a chance to live better than he could offer. Witnesses said his hands trembled as he hugged each child, whispering words of love and apology. The children, too young to fully understand, clung to him, asking when they could come home. It was a goodbye no parent should ever have to face.
Orphanage staff later revealed that the father had come several times before making his final decision. Each visit ended with him leaving in tears, unable to go through with it. But with rent overdue and no money for food, he had no other option. His decision wasn’t born from neglect — it was an act of painful love, a desperate move to ensure his children wouldn’t go hungry.
When his story spread online, thousands of Malaysians were moved to tears. Many offered financial help and emotional support, while others shared similar stories of struggling to survive in a harsh economy. His courage and honesty opened a national conversation about poverty, single parenthood, and the hidden battles many families face in silence.
Charity groups have since stepped in to help the man and his children, with some offering temporary housing and employment opportunities. The father expressed gratitude through tears, saying he never wanted sympathy — only a chance to rebuild and someday reunite with his kids under one roof.
